Understanding Different Types of Math Problems

Mathematics is a broad field encompassing numerous branches. Recognizing the type of math problem you're facing is the first step towards finding a solution. Let's explore some common categories:

Arithmetic

Arithmetic deals with basic operations like addition, subtraction, multiplication, and division. It also includes concepts like fractions, decimals, and percentages. Mastering arithmetic is crucial as it forms the foundation for more advanced math.

  • Fractions: Understanding how to add, subtract, multiply, and divide fractions is essential.
  • Percentages: Knowing how to calculate percentages and apply them to real-world scenarios is a valuable skill.

Algebra

Algebra introduces variables and symbols to represent unknown quantities. It involves solving equations, inequalities, and working with functions. A strong understanding of algebra is vital for higher-level mathematics and various scientific fields.

  • Equations: Solving linear and quadratic equations is a fundamental algebraic skill.
  • Inequalities: Understanding how to solve and graph inequalities is important for representing constraints and ranges of values.

Geometry

Geometry focuses on the properties and relationships of shapes and spaces. It involves concepts like angles, lines, triangles, circles, and three-dimensional figures. Geometry is used in fields like architecture, engineering, and computer graphics.

  • Triangles: Understanding the properties of different types of triangles (e.g., right triangles, equilateral triangles) is crucial.
  • Circles: Knowing how to calculate the area and circumference of circles is a fundamental geometric skill.

Calculus

Calculus deals with rates of change and accumulation. It introduces concepts like derivatives and integrals, which are used to model and solve problems in physics, engineering, economics, and other fields. Calculus builds upon algebra and trigonometry.

  • Derivatives: Understanding how to find the derivative of a function is essential for analyzing its rate of change.
  • Integrals: Knowing how to calculate the integral of a function is important for finding areas and volumes.

Statistics

Statistics involves collecting, analyzing, interpreting, and presenting data. It includes concepts like mean, median, mode, standard deviation, and probability. Statistics is used in a wide range of fields, including healthcare, business, and social sciences.

  • Mean, Median, Mode: Understanding these measures of central tendency is fundamental to statistical analysis.
  • Probability: Knowing how to calculate probabilities is important for understanding the likelihood of events.

Trigonometry

Trigonometry focuses on the relationships between angles and sides of triangles. It introduces trigonometric functions like sine, cosine, and tangent, which are used to solve problems in navigation, surveying, and physics. Trigonometry builds upon geometry and algebra.

  • Sine, Cosine, Tangent: Understanding these trigonometric functions is essential for solving problems involving triangles.
  • Unit Circle: The unit circle provides a visual representation of trigonometric functions and their values.

Strategies for Solving Math Problems

Regardless of the type of math problem you're facing, certain strategies can help you approach it effectively:

Read Carefully and Understand the Problem

Before attempting to solve a math problem, take the time to read it carefully and understand what it's asking. Identify the key information and what you're trying to find. For word problems, this is especially crucial.

Break Down Complex Problems

If a math problem seems overwhelming, break it down into smaller, more manageable steps. This can make the problem less daunting and easier to solve. Identify the individual operations or concepts involved and tackle them one at a time.

Use Visual Aids

Visual aids like diagrams, graphs, and charts can be helpful for understanding and solving math problems, especially in geometry and algebra. Draw a diagram to represent the problem, or graph an equation to visualize its solution.

Show Your Work

Showing your work is important for several reasons. It allows you to track your progress, identify errors, and communicate your reasoning to others. Even if you don't arrive at the correct answer, showing your work can earn you partial credit.

Check Your Answer

After solving a math problem, take the time to check your answer. Plug your answer back into the original equation or problem to see if it makes sense. If possible, use a different method to solve the problem and compare your answers.

Tackling Specific Types of Math Problems

Let's delve into specific strategies for some common types of math problems:

Word Problems

Word problems often pose a challenge because they require you to translate real-world scenarios into mathematical equations. Here's how to approach them:

  1. Read the problem carefully: Identify what the problem is asking you to find.
  2. Identify key information: Look for numbers, units, and relationships between quantities.
  3. Define variables: Assign variables to represent the unknown quantities.
  4. Write an equation: Translate the problem into a mathematical equation using the variables you defined.
  5. Solve the equation: Use algebraic techniques to solve for the unknown variables.
  6. Check your answer: Make sure your answer makes sense in the context of the problem.

Equations and Inequalities

Solving equations and inequalities involves isolating the variable of interest. Here are some key techniques:

  • Use inverse operations: To isolate a variable, perform the inverse operation on both sides of the equation or inequality.
  • Simplify expressions: Combine like terms and simplify expressions to make the equation or inequality easier to solve.
  • Follow the order of operations: Remember to follow the order of operations (PEMDAS/BODMAS) when simplifying expressions.

Fractions and Percentages

Working with fractions and percentages requires a solid understanding of their properties and relationships. Here are some tips:

  • Convert between fractions, decimals, and percentages: Be able to convert fractions to decimals and percentages, and vice versa.
  • Simplify fractions: Reduce fractions to their simplest form by dividing the numerator and denominator by their greatest common factor.
  • Use proportions: Set up proportions to solve problems involving ratios and percentages.

Building Confidence in Math

Math anxiety is a real phenomenon, but it can be overcome. Here are some tips for building confidence in math:

  • Practice regularly: The more you practice, the more comfortable you'll become with math concepts and problem-solving techniques.
  • Start with the basics: Make sure you have a solid foundation in the fundamentals before moving on to more advanced topics.
  • Don't be afraid to ask for help: If you're struggling with a concept or problem, don't hesitate to ask your teacher, tutor, or classmates for help.
  • Celebrate your successes: Acknowledge and celebrate your accomplishments, no matter how small. This will help you build confidence and stay motivated.
